My Son DOB is 1st May 2001. He wants to apply for NDA Exams this Year. Is it possible

NDA Age Limit Criteria 2020 is as follows:-

Only unmarried male candidates born not earlier than July 02, 2001, and not later than July 01, 2004, are eligible to apply for NDA (1) 2020.

The date of birth mentioned in the Matriculation or Secondary School Leaving Certificate will be accepted by UPSC. These certificates are required to be submitted only after the results of the NDA written exams are declared.

As your son is born before 2nd July 2001 he is ineligible to apply for the NDA Examination.
